Product Description:
The HNL05.1R-0649-N0127-N-A5-NNNF is a mains choke manufactured by Bosch Rexroth Indramat and supplied within the HNL Mains Chokes series. In a regenerative drive system it is wired between the converter and the facility mains to smooth current peaks and limit conducted interference, protecting both the supply network and connected inverters from high-frequency harmonics. By adding inductance to the AC side of the installation, the choke stabilizes the voltage profile during motoring and regeneration cycles common in automated production equipment.
The choke can carry a continuous line current of 127 A, so it is suited for medium-power multi-axis cabinets that draw steady high currents. Its liquid circuit, specified as Liquid Cooling, transports heat away from the windings and keeps copper temperatures within limits even under full load. With a protection rating of IP00, the unit must be mounted inside a closed control enclosure where touch-safe barriers are present. The magnetic core presents a nominal inductance of 649 µH; this value sets the choke’s impedance at line frequency and directly defines its capability to attenuate ripple. Joule losses produced by copper resistance and core hysteresis amount to 1000 W at rated conditions, and the cooling loop is dimensioned to remove that heat to the plant water supply.
Hardware identification lists Design Version 1, indicating first-generation mechanical dimensions and terminal spacing used across the series. The supply topology is marked as Regenerative, meaning the choke is sized for bidirectional energy flow during braking events. Shipping mass is 50 kg, a factor that influences panel reinforcement and handling fixtures during installation. Within the broader HNL Mains Chokes family, this model occupies the upper tier for current rating while maintaining standardized mounting footprints, allowing engineers to interchange units without changing cabinet layouts.
